WebSep 27, 2013 · A cystoscopy is an examination of the inside of the bladder using flexible, tube-like telescope called a cystoscope. This instrument is carefully passed up the urethra and into the bladder. This procedure is usually done under local anaesthetic, without overnight staying in hospital. If you think you have a urinary tract infection, tell your healthcare provider, because cystoscopy should not be done. Your healthcare provider may check your urine for infection before doing the procedure. porsche 911 turbo performance
